**以前のリビジョンの文書です**
個人的な基本設定
Debian系でaptを使った場合の初期配置を想定しての話。
インストール後にとりあえずやる設定。
インストール後にとりあえずやる設定。
- AutoIndexの無効化
- <code> # a2dismod autoindex </code>
- サーバシグネチャ サーバのバージョン等を非表示に。(たいした意味はないので最近はどうでもよくなった。 <code> # pwd /etc/apache2/conf.d # cat security | grep Sign ServerSignature Off #ServerSignature On </code>
- .htaccessを有効にするとき
- HTTPの場合は、/etc/apache2/sites-available/defaultでAllowOverride All
- HTTPSの場合は、/etc/apache2/sites-available/default-sslでAllowOverride All
- %2Fを含むURLを有効にするとき
- HTTPの場合は、/etc/apache2/sites-available/defaultにAllowEncodedSlashes On
- HTTPSの場合は、/etc/apache2/sites-available/default-sslにAllowEncodedSlashes On
- “File does not exist: /var/www/favicon.ico”がちょっと…
- <code>Redirect 404 /favicon.ico <Location /favicon.ico> ErrorDocument 404 “No favicon” </Location> </code>